EBC DP42149R 1785193, car EBC. Brake Pad Set Front, Yellowstuff Street and Track EBC YELLOWSTUFF STREET AND TRACK BRAKE PAD SET. EBC's Yellowstuff Street and Track brake pads deliver extreme braking performance when they're cold or hot thanks to...

Out of stock
  • ShipAmount
  • $0.00
  • RevType
  • 2
  • Manufacturer
  • EBC
  • Sku
  • E35DP42149R
  • Identity
  • 37480650150

Customers Also Searched